作者jami520 (我的生命因你而發光)
看板PHP
標題[請益] PHP如何匯入30幾萬筆的xlsx檔案呢?
時間Thu Apr 3 10:46:02 2014
目前使用phpEXCEL匯入小檔案還可以
但是現階段有一個xlsx檔案32萬筆的數據要匯入
跑起來結果就出現錯誤如下
Allowed memory size of 134217728 bytes exhausted (tried to allocate 210825063
bytes) in /public_html/test2/PHPExcel/Reader/Excel2007.php
不曉得有沒有什麼方式可以解決呢? 謝謝
--
※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 182.235.162.78
※ 文章網址: http://www.ptt.cc/bbs/PHP/M.1396493164.A.22A.html
推 alog:搜尋本板舊文章 04/03 12:13
→ npulove:修改 memory_limit 04/03 13:34
推 userid:你可以上傳後,先把檔案存起來。使用類似 cron 的方式 04/04 16:32
→ userid:每次讀取如 1000 筆數,直到 EOF 後通知使用者完成即可 04/04 16:33